Endoscopic Stone Composition Identification: Is Accuracy Improved by Stone Appearance During Laser Lithotripsy?

Abstract

OBJECTIVE

To evaluate if videos during laser lithotripsy increase accuracy and confidence of stone identification by urologists compared to still pictures.

METHODS

We obtained representative pictures and videos of 4 major stone types from 8 different patients during ureteroscopy with holmium laser lithotripsy. A REDCap survey was created and emailed to members of the Endourological Society. The survey included a picture followed by the corresponding video of each stone undergoing laser lithotripsy and additional clinical information. Each picture and video included multiple-choice questions about stone composition and response confidence level. Accuracy, confidence levels, and rates of rectification (change from incorrect to correct answer) or confounding (correct to incorrect) after watching videos were analyzed.

RESULTS

One hundred eighty-seven urologists responded to the survey. The accuracy rate of stone identification with pictures was 43.8% vs 46.1% with videos (P = .27). Accuracy for individual stones was low and highly variable. Video only improved accuracy for 1 cystine stone. After viewing videos, participants were more likely to rectify vs confound their answers. Urologists were more likely to be confident with videos than pictures alone (65.4% vs 53.7%, respectively; P <.001); however, confident answers were not more likely to yield accurate predictions with videos vs still pictures.

CONCLUSION

Stone identification by urologists is marginally improved with videos vs pictures alone. Overall, accuracy in stone identification is low irrespective of confidence level, picture, and lithotripsy video visualization. Urologists should be cautious in using endoscopic stone appearance to direct metabolic management.

摘要

目的

评估与静态图像相比,激光碎石术中的视频是否能提高泌尿科医生对结石识别的准确性和信心。

方法

我们从 8 名不同患者的输尿管镜钬激光碎石术中获得了 4 种主要结石类型的有代表性的图片和视频。创建了一个 REDCap 调查,并通过电子邮件发送给内镜学会的成员。该调查包括一张图片,随后是对每种进行激光碎石术的结石的相应视频,以及其他临床信息。每张图片和视频都包含关于结石成分和置信水平的多项选择题。分析了观看视频后的准确性、置信度水平以及纠正(从错误答案变为正确答案)或混淆(正确答案变为错误答案)的比率。

结果

187 名泌尿科医生对该调查做出了回应。使用图片的结石识别准确率为 43.8%,而使用视频的准确率为 46.1%(P=0.27)。单个结石的准确率较低且差异较大。视频仅提高了 1 例胱氨酸结石的准确率。观看视频后,参与者更有可能纠正而不是混淆他们的答案。与仅看图片相比,泌尿科医生观看视频后更有可能有信心(分别为 65.4%和 53.7%;P<.001);然而,观看视频并不能比看图片更有可能做出准确的预测。

结论

与单独使用图片相比,泌尿科医生使用视频可略微提高结石识别的准确性。总体而言,无论信心水平、图片和碎石术视频可视化如何,结石识别的准确性都很低。泌尿科医生在使用内镜下结石外观来指导代谢管理时应谨慎。
